  • Publication number: 20140186841
    Abstract: A method, system, and apparatus for analysis of a biological sample includes receiving the sample, wherein the sample includes deoxyribonucleic acid (DNA), lysing the sample to obtain access to the DNA included in the sample, purifying the DNA in the sample to isolate the DNA from other components in the sample, amplifying the DNA, separating fragments of the amplified DNA, detecting the separated fragments using laser induced fluorescence, based on the detecting, generating a profile of the DNA in the received sample, comparing the generated profile with profiles of DNA stored in a database, and upon determining that the generated profile matches one of the stored profiles, identifying the source from which the stored profile was obtained, wherein the receiving, lysing, purifying, amplifying, and detecting are performed on corresponding portions of a microfluidic device, and wherein transporting the sample and the DNA to the portions of the microfluidic device and enabling the lysing, purifying, amplifying,
    Type: Application
    Filed: September 23, 2013
    Publication date: July 3, 2014
    Inventors: Frederic ZENHAUSERN, Ralf LENIGK, Jianing YANG, Zhi CAI, Alan NORDQUIST, Stanley D. SMITH, David MAGGIANO, Glen MCCARTY, Mrinalini PRASAD, Karem LINAN, Baiju THOMAS, Edward OLAYA, Cedric HURTH, Darryl COX, Mark RICHARD
